在现代信息技术中,雷达技术和数据库管理是两个极为重要的领域,它们分别服务于军事和商业用途。然而,在看似毫无交集的背后,雷达目标检测机制和数据库索引技术之间存在着某种奇妙的联系。本文将探讨这两种技术的基本原理、实际应用以及未来发展的趋势,并尝试揭示它们之间的潜在关联。
# 一、雷达技术:天空中的守护者
雷达(Radar)是一种利用无线电波探测并确定目标的位置的技术,广泛应用于航空、航海、军事、气象等多个领域。早在20世纪30年代,雷达就已经开始被研发和使用,其主要功能是通过发射电磁波来检测远处的物体,并接收反射回来的信号。
雷达的工作原理基于电磁波在空中的传播特性。当一个脉冲无线电波从天线发出后,如果遇到目标物(如飞机、船舶等),部分信号会被散射并返回到雷达接收器中。根据接收到的回波,可以计算出目标的距离和方位信息。此外,通过比较发射与接收信号之间的相位差还可以获取目标的速度信息。
近年来,随着技术的进步,雷达系统变得更加智能和高效。例如,采用合成孔径雷达(SAR)等先进技术能够提高成像质量和分辨率;使用多普勒雷达可以更精确地测量移动物体的运动状态;基于机器学习的人工智能算法则有助于提升识别与分类能力。所有这些改进都使得雷达技术成为现代科技不可或缺的一部分。
# 二、数据库索引:信息时代的导航者
与雷达在空中的守护角色相对应,数据库索引是信息技术领域中一种极为重要的技术手段。它是通过某种方法将数据进行组织和存储,以提高查询效率的重要工具。在大数据时代背景下,随着海量数据的不断增长以及处理复杂性的增加,传统的直接访问方式已经难以满足高效检索的需求。
数据库索引的基本原理是建立一个指向数据记录或文件的指针集合,这些指针按照某种排序顺序排列。当用户需要查找特定的数据时,可以通过查询相应的索引来快速定位到具体的位置,从而大大减少了搜索时间和资源消耗。常见的索引类型包括B树、哈希表和位图等。
在实际应用中,数据库索引可以应用于各种场景,如电子商务网站中的商品推荐系统、社交媒体平台上的用户帖子搜索功能以及金融行业中的交易记录查询等。合理的设计与构建能显著提升系统的整体性能,并为用户提供更加流畅的服务体验。
# 三、雷达目标检测机制的启发对数据库索引技术的影响
在探讨这两项看似不相关的技术之间的联系之前,我们不妨先思考这样一个问题:为什么我们要从一个空中飞行器的位置和速度数据中获取信息,而不直接询问飞行员呢?答案在于雷达系统能够实时地进行大规模且快速的数据收集与处理。这实际上为数据库索引提供了一种新的视角——利用类似机制来优化存储和检索操作。
首先,我们可以借鉴雷达目标检测中的信号处理技术。在雷达系统中,通过复杂的数学模型可以对回波信号进行分析以提取有用信息。同样地,在构建高效数据库索引时,也可以采用类似的策略。通过对原始数据进行预处理、分类或者聚类等操作,有助于减少冗余存储空间并加快搜索速度。
其次,雷达系统的多传感器融合技术对于提高目标识别准确性具有重要意义。在实际应用中,多个不同类型的传感器可以协同工作以提供更全面的数据支持。这一理念同样适用于数据库索引设计当中:结合多种索引类型(如全文索引、聚簇索引等)能够更好地覆盖各种查询需求并实现整体优化。
最后,雷达技术中的目标跟踪机制也为我们提供了灵感。在雷达系统中,即使面对快速移动的目标,也可以通过持续更新的位置信息来进行有效追踪。数据库索引同样可以借鉴这种思路:通过定期维护和调整以确保其始终处于最佳状态,并能够适应不断变化的数据分布情况。
# 四、展望未来:技术融合与创新
随着科技的不断进步以及跨学科研究趋势的发展,我们有理由相信雷达技术和数据库索引之间的联系将会变得更加紧密。例如,在物联网时代背景下,大量的传感器节点将产生前所未有的海量数据。如何有效地管理和利用这些信息将成为一个亟待解决的问题。
此外,人工智能算法的发展也为两种技术相互启发提供了更多可能性:机器学习能够帮助优化雷达目标检测模型以及数据库索引的设计策略;反之亦然,借助于数据库中的历史记录和模式识别能力则有助于提升雷达系统的工作精度与鲁棒性。这些交叉领域的探索无疑将为未来科技带来无限可能。
总之,尽管雷达技术和数据库索引看似分属不同领域,但它们之间存在着许多潜在联系,并且正逐渐走向融合。通过深入研究并借鉴彼此的优点,我们有望开发出更加高效、智能的信息处理系统以应对日益复杂的数据挑战。